Mid-sized to large firms may rely on fee-based social media monitoring tools like Radian 6 , Alterian SM2 , Cision or Vocus which provide automated sentiment tracking, while global brands can use tools like Neilsen BuzzMetrics or Cymfony. Share this on Technorati. Tweet This!
